LensSync: Lens-Camera Compatibility & Diagnostic Database with Real-Time Troubleshooting

A membership-based diagnostic service where photographers submit photos of their setup (camera model, lens, firmware versions, autofocus settings) plus a video of the failure. Certified camera technicians and lens specialists review within 4 hours and provide a root-cause diagnosis (lens defect, camera sensor issue, firmware bug, incompatibility, or user error) with a specific fix path. Members get unlimited submissions, priority support, and access to a searchable database of 10,000+ documented lens-camera failure patterns.

Value Proposition

Cuts diagnosis time from days/weeks of forum-crawling to 4 hours with expert certainty. Eliminates guesswork about whether to return the lens, send the camera for repair, or try a firmware rollback. Photographers avoid losing clients or rescheduling shoots. Beats forums (slow, contradictory) and manufacturer support (generic, slow, often unhelpful).

Target Audience

Professional and semi-professional photographers ($2k+ annual camera spend), wedding/commercial shooters, studio photographers who cannot afford shoot downtime

Key Features

  • Video + metadata submission portal (EXIF auto-parsing, firmware version capture)
  • Expert technician review pool (partnerships with authorized service centers and independent repair specialists)
  • Searchable failure database indexed by camera model, lens model, firmware version, and failure type

Original Problem

Camera autofocus mysteriously fails with specific lenses, breaking professional shoots

Photographers experience sudden autofocus failure with particular lenses on their cameras, forcing them to abandon shoots, miss critical moments, or resort to manual focusing. Current solutions like generic troubleshooting forums and manufacturer support are slow and often unhelpful, leaving photographers unable to diagnose whether it's a lens issue, camera issue, or compatibility problem—costing them time, money, and client trust.
